Casting Center entrance

The Main Entrance Doors to the casting Center...

I keep it because it reminds me of the day I went on a engineering interview for a Locksmith (Key Control) a few years ago. I thought I had the position, I had been managing a similar system for the entire Air Force Base I'm at with 9 million dollar lock system, First interview went well with my diciplin and experience...Then the Locksmith Supervisor gave me good feedback...I recieved a good tour of the facilities and even delivered some keys for a job. I went to my third interview back at the casting office and sat next to another person listening to the whole 'what you need to get started' speech. I was excited, thought mine was next. But the Senior interviewer dismissed the individual and gave me the bad news with a little try again when you get out of the military advice... and send me on my way. I know now that I didn't have enough automotive experience. you all know what I mean with that... I then decided to stay in the Air Force till I retire. I'll pursuit it again then.
